Freifunk: Unterschied zwischen den Versionen

Aus Shea Wiki
Zur Navigation springen Zur Suche springen
Keine Bearbeitungszusammenfassung
Keine Bearbeitungszusammenfassung
Zeile 37: Zeile 37:
uci commit
uci commit
autoupdater
autoupdater
</nowiki></pre>
== Temp ==
remue-01
<pre><nowiki>
echo bat0=bat0 >>/run/network/ifstate
auto bat0
iface bat0 inet manual
#iface bat0 inet static
#        address 10.43.8.2
#        netmask 255.255.248.0
        pre-up modprobe batman-adv
        pre-up ip link add bat0 type batadv||:
        post-up ip link set dev bat0 up
        post-up batctl it 10000
        post-up batctl gw server 1024Mbit/1024Mbit
        post-up ip rule add from all fwmark 0x1 table ffnet
        post-up ip rule add iif bat0 table ffnet
        post-up ip rule add iif lo lookup ffnet suppress_prefixlength 0
        post-up ip a a 10.43.8.2 dev bat0
        post-up ip a a 2a03:2260:115:100::2 bat0
        pre-down batctl if del bat0
        pre-down ip addr flush dev bat0
        post-down ip rule del from all fwmark 0x1 table ffnet
        post-down ip rule del iif bat0 table ffnet
        post-down ip rule del iif lo lookup ffnet suppress_prefixlength 0
#      post-down modprobe -r batman-adv
#
#iface bat0 inet6 static
#        address 2a03:2260:115:100::2
#        netmask 64
        post-up ip -6 rule add from all fwmark 0x1 table ffnet
        post-up ip -6 rule add iif bat0 table ffnet
        post-up ip -6 rule add iif lo lookup ffnet suppress_prefixlength 0
        post-down ip -6 rule del from all fwmark 0x1 table ffnet
        post-down ip -6 rule del iif bat0 table ffnet
        post-down ip -6 rule del iif lo lookup ffnet suppress_prefixlength 0
        post-down ip link del $IFACE
</nowiki></pre>
</nowiki></pre>



Version vom 1. Januar 1970, 01:00 Uhr

Freifunk

Administration

Tunnel IPs vom Rheinland: https://docs.google.com/document/d/1MymnkVW6Rv_ZSYViGo8od3lO6NHJ_-ircy_lu2_OJso/edit (vieles darin ist aber falsch)

Sonstiges

Ausgeführte Befehle

git clone https://github.com/FreiFunkMuenster/ffmap-backend
apt install python3-bs4


Knoten umziehen

uci add_list autoupdater.stable.mirror=http://[2a01:4f8:162:10d2:5:23:d0:0f]/site-ffms/stable/sysupgrade
uci del_list autoupdater.stable.mirror=http://firmware.ffms/site-ffms/stable/sysupgrade
uci set autoupdater.stable.good_signatures=0
uci commit
autoupdater


Temp

remue-01

echo bat0=bat0 >>/run/network/ifstate

auto bat0
iface bat0 inet manual
#iface bat0 inet static
#        address 10.43.8.2
#        netmask 255.255.248.0
        pre-up modprobe batman-adv
        pre-up ip link add bat0 type batadv||:
        post-up ip link set dev bat0 up
        post-up batctl it 10000
        post-up batctl gw server 1024Mbit/1024Mbit
        post-up ip rule add from all fwmark 0x1 table ffnet
        post-up ip rule add iif bat0 table ffnet
        post-up ip rule add iif lo lookup ffnet suppress_prefixlength 0
        post-up ip a a 10.43.8.2 dev bat0
        post-up ip a a 2a03:2260:115:100::2 bat0
        pre-down batctl if del bat0
        pre-down ip addr flush dev bat0
        post-down ip rule del from all fwmark 0x1 table ffnet
        post-down ip rule del iif bat0 table ffnet
        post-down ip rule del iif lo lookup ffnet suppress_prefixlength 0
#       post-down modprobe -r batman-adv
#
#iface bat0 inet6 static
#        address 2a03:2260:115:100::2
#        netmask 64
        post-up ip -6 rule add from all fwmark 0x1 table ffnet
        post-up ip -6 rule add iif bat0 table ffnet
        post-up ip -6 rule add iif lo lookup ffnet suppress_prefixlength 0 
        post-down ip -6 rule del from all fwmark 0x1 table ffnet
        post-down ip -6 rule del iif bat0 table ffnet
        post-down ip -6 rule del iif lo lookup ffnet suppress_prefixlength 0
        post-down ip link del $IFACE



KategorieWissen